Book excerpt: Doctors thrust into residency usually must repay hundreds of thousands of dollars in student loans, but most do not have the financial or business education to help them on their journey. In The Young Physician's Guide to Money and Life, the authors share proven systems and strategies to help aspiring, new, and practicing physicians plot a path to financial freedom. Learn how to: - keep more of your hard-earned money while paying off school loans faster; - employ strategies that could save you tens of thousands of dollars; - avoid getting stuck in investment traps that cost you money; and - earn a higher income by following the ten commandments of contract negotiation. You'll also read two case studies that show how two different physicians paid off their student loans before turning thirty-five so they could retire when they were young and healthy.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Young doctors starting practice today face a unique set of challenges. The typical physician has $185,000 of student loans. The relative priority given to debt paydown, lifestyle upgrades, and saving/investing will have a determinative effect on the financial arc of your future. The transition from residency or fellowship to full-time practice as an attending physician is the only time new doctors can substantially upgrade lifestyle, while also establishing powerful savings habits, placing themselves on the fast track toward financial independence. This book provides a basic course in practical financial literacy in less than 100 pages. It demonstrates why optimal financial sequencing of savings and debt paydown is so important. Used as a textbook in the Business of Medicine Course at East Carolina University's Brody School of Medicine, this edition is designed to work more broadly for other institutions teaching business of medicine courses and for new physicians starting out in practice. Recalling his days in medical school, Marc Lyles, senior director of health care affairs for the Association of American Medical Colleges said, "Whenever we asked a business question we were always told, 'Don't worry about that. You need to learn the medical side before you worry about the business side.'" He states that between 2003 and 2007, the majority of students were satisfied with their medical and clinical training. However, less than half felt that enough time was devoted to the practice of medicine, especially to medical economics. The Brody School of Medicine addresses that discrepancy, offering its Business of Medicine Course as a fourth-year elective and as a postgraduate class for students in the Department of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ation. Topics addressed include time value of money, contracts, RVUs, disability and life insurance, and investment plans such as traditional IRAs and Roth IRAs. In 2015, the Business of Medicine Course received a positive score of 4.68/5 (94%) for its value to medical students, and Beyond Residency received a score of 3.89/4 (97%) for its effectiveness in teaching students the business of medicine.
